Universal Orlando Resort

Universal Orlando Resort is a world-renowned amusement park and tourist attraction located at 6000 Universal Boulevard in Orlando, Florida. This sprawling resort offers visitors a thrilling and immersive experience with its exciting rides, shows, and attractions inspired by popular movies and TV shows. From the Wizarding World of Harry Potter to thrilling roller coasters like The Incredible Hulk and Hollywood Rip Ride Rockit, there is something for everyone to enjoy at Universal Orlando Resort. In addition to the theme parks, the resort also features luxurious hotels, restaurants, shopping, and entertainment options, making it the perfect destination for a fun-filled vacation for the whole family.

"I recently visited Universal Studios Orlando and it was an experience filled with both thrills and patience. The park itself is beautiful and amazing, offering a vast array of attractions and entertainment that truly brings movie magic to life. The rides are top-notch, with cutting-edge technology that immerses you in the world of your favorite films and shows. However, the long lines can be a bit annoying. While it’s understandable given the park’s popularity, the wait times for some attractions were quite lengthy, often exceeding an hour. This can be especially challenging if you’re visiting with young children or during peak seasons. On the upside, the park offers several kinds of entertainment to make the wait more comfortable, and the staff are always friendly and helpful, ensuring the environment remains upbeat. Plus, there are plenty of shows and smaller attractions to enjoy while waiting for the big-ticket rides. Overall, Universal Studios Orlando is a must-visit for movie buffs and thrill-seekers. Just be prepared for the lines, and consider investing in an Express Pass if you’re short on time. Despite the waits, the experience is well worth it!"
